Lomas, James was born on March 1, 1990.
He attended Ecclesfield School, in Chapeltown.
Lomas was one of the three original Billy Elliots of the original West End production of Billy Elliot the Musical. He continued performing until 7 January 2006. Lomas was featured in Strictly Dance Fever performing part of the Musical finale, and in several television interviews and short clips related to the Musical.
In July 2006 he played the title role of young blind Nicholas Saunderson in the new musical "Number Horizon" in Penistone / Northern England and was well received for his performances.
Lomas got a place at the dance and drama school "Millennium" in London, where he started his studies from September 2006 onwards. He also starred in the short film King Ponce, which debuted at the 2007 Cannes Film Festival.
He also featured in an episode of Super Sweet 16 United Kingdom as a dance partner for the party. After leaving drama school James Jacob-Lomas was in Dirty Dancing, as Swing/Understudy: Jordan.
And Toured with Joseph and his Amazing Technicolor Dream coat understudy Joseph.
Lomas played Espresso in Starlight Express in Bochum, Germany. He is currently in the Band Gypsy Queens based in France: vocalist and drummer.
